Hearts of Iron IV is a grand strategy wargame developed by Paradox Development Studio and published by Paradox Interactive. Released on June 6, 2016, it is the sequel to Hearts of Iron III and part of the Hearts of Iron series of grand strategy games focusing on World War II. The player may take control of any nation in the world in either 1936 or 1939 and lead them to victory or defeat against other countries.

It's not that they're useless it's more that the trade-offs don't make a lot of sense. If you have the industry for field hospitals you also often have a fairly good manpower pool and similarly if you lack manpower you often also lack the industry for field hospitals.

Field hospitals have a runaway effect associated with them, due to how a general (or a field marshal) receives points toward his next promotion. Promotion points earned each day have a multiplier, based on the day's casualty ratio. If the casualty ratio is in your favor for example by 4 to 1 or more, your general gets points toward his next promotion at 4x the nominal rate, while the enemy general gets points toward his next promotion at only 0.25x the nominal rate. If your general and your field marshal are as a result is getting promotion points 16 times as fast as the enemy general and the enemy field marshal, your general and your field marshal soon get combat bonus gains that the enemy general and field marshal won't see for a long time, tipping the casualty ratio even more in your favor. Short version: A field hospital support company helps your generals and field marshals get promoted, which in turn leads to the casualty ratio shifting even more in your favor.
